Aussies Jason Kubler and Chris O’Connell have each made it by means of to the second spherical of the Qatar Open, however in contrasting fashions.
Kubler was given a serving to hand when Russia’s Aslan Karatsev retired on Monday afternoon on the Khalifa Worldwide Tennis and Squash Complicated in Doha.
The 29-year-old Queenslander, ranked No.74, was forward 7-6 (7-4) 1-Zero when Karatsev, the world No.101, pulled out.
Karatsev gave up the primary set tie-break with a double fault and retired after only one sport of the second set.
Kubler has already loved success in doubles this yr, successful the Australian Open doubles final month alongside Rinky Hijikata, after they beat Hugo Nys and Jan Zielinski.
The Australian will face Canadian No.2 seed Felix Auger-Aliassime subsequent.
O’Connell, ranked No.94, adopted Kubler on courtroom and beat the veteran Spaniard Fernando Verdasco 6-1 3-6 6-0.
Sydneysider O’Connell will play the winner of Tuesday’s match between Spaniard Roberto Bautista Agut, the No. 5 seed, and Hungary’s Marton Fucsovics within the final 16.
